Size and Weight Comparison The size of a lens is a crucial factor to consider when comparing two lenses. TTArtisan 27mm F2.8 is the longer of the two lenses at 41mm. The Fujifilm 27mm F2.8 with a length of 23mm, is 18mm shorter. Besides being longer, the TTArtisan 27mm F2.8 also has a larger diameter of 68mm compared to the Fujifilm 27mm F2.8's 61mm diameter.

Comparison image of the TTArtisan 27mm F2.8 and the Fujifilm 27mm F2.8 Size and Weight The weight of a lens is equally significant as its external dimensions, particularly if you intend to handhold your camera and lens combination for extended periods. Fujifilm 27mm F2.8 weighs 78g, 21% (22g) lighter than the TTArtisan 27mm F2.8's weight of 100g.
Filter Threads
Both the TTArtisan 27mm F2.8 and the Fujifilm 27mm F2.8 have the same Filter thread size of 39mm .

Lens Mounts
The TTArtisan 27mm F2.8 has the Nikon Z lens mount whereas the Fujifilm 27mm F2.8 has the Fujifilm X lens mount . Some of the latest released cameras that are compatible with these mounts are RED Komodo-X 6K Z , Nikon Z50 II and Nikon Z30 for the Nikon Z Mount and Fujifilm X-T30 III , Fujifilm X-E5 and Fujifilm X-M5 for the Fujifilm X Mount.
TTArtisan 27mm F2.8 is also available in the Sony E and Fujifilm X mounts.
